Cervical Spinal Canal Stenosis
Cervical Spinal Canal Stenosis is a condition where the
spinal canal in the neck (cervical spine) becomes narrowed, putting
pressure on the spinal cord and surrounding nerves. This narrowing
often results from degenerative changes, herniated discs, or arthritis,
and can significantly affect mobility, balance, and overall quality of life.
Common Symptoms
- ✔ Neck pain and stiffness
- ✔ Tingling, numbness, or weakness in arms, hands, or shoulders
- ✔ Loss of grip strength or difficulty with fine motor skills
- ✔ Pain radiating from the neck into the arms
- ✔ Difficulty maintaining balance while walking
- ✔ Headaches related to neck strain
- ✔ In severe cases, loss of bladder or bowel control
Causes
- ✔ Age-related degeneration of spinal discs
- ✔ Herniated or bulging discs in the cervical spine
- ✔ Thickening of ligaments (ligamentum flavum hypertrophy)
- ✔ Osteoarthritis and bone spurs pressing on nerves
- ✔ Past injuries or trauma to the neck
- ✔ Congenital (born with) narrow spinal canal
Diagnosis
To confirm Cervical Spinal Canal Stenosis, doctors begin with a
detailed history and physical exam, followed by imaging tests:
- X-rays – show bone changes and alignment issues
- MRI scans – visualize spinal cord and nerve compression
- CT scans – provide detailed 3D imaging of bones and discs
- Electromyography (EMG) – measures nerve and muscle function
